Abstract

The invention relates to a method for artificially culturing artemisia annua linn in high altitude areas and belongs to the technical field of agricultural science. The method mainly comprises the followings steps: the diameter of soil particles of a seedbed is smaller than 0.2cm, the width of furrow is 100cm, the height thereof is 15 to 20cm and the length is 5 to 10m; the seeding time is the end of February to early March and the seeding quantity is 200g/mu; transplanting is carried out when the temperature of the seedbed is 15 DEG C to 30 DEG C, the humidity is 40 to 50 percent, the height of the plant is 10 to 15cm and the length of the root is more than 5cm; the center width of a ridge and furrow is 0.8 to 1m and the depth of the ridge and furrow is 30 to 40cm; the spacing between rows is 0.40*0.80m or 0.50*1.0m and 1300 or 2000 artemisia annua linn is planted in each mu; 0.7si of plastic film are used for mulching the artemisia annua linn along furrow surface after permanent planting; seeds are compensated after ten days, watering is carried out for once to twice everyday, and after transplanting for 7 days, 10 to 15kg of fertilizers are applied for each mu or 0.3 percent of liquid fertilizers are poured and applied; the humidity of the field in seedling stage is kept between 60 and 70 percent; additional fertilizer are applied for twice; 5 to 10kg of N.P.K compound fertilizer is used in squaring stage; and pouring and applying are carried out after 1000kg of water is watered. The invention has simple and convenient operation of the method and short seedling stage, can effectively improve the yield of artemisia annua linn and the content of active components and is suitable for artificial culturing of artemisia annua linn in the areas with altitude more than 1900m.

Background technology:
Artemisia annua (Artemisia annua L.) is a composite family artemisia annual herb, is the important source material plant of extracting qinghaosu.The Artemether that utilizes qinghaosu to make has very high antimalarial active, listed the special effect Chinese kind of WHO " essential drugs handbook " treatment malaria in, being that China has one of herbal species of independent intellectual property right, also is the herbal species by the U.S. FDA authentication few in number up to now.Extracting qinghaosu from natural artemisia annua plant is the unique source that obtains qinghaosu at present, because artemisinin-based drug world market demand increases severely, wild artemisia annua resource can not satisfy the demand of pharmacy corporation, and artificial domesticating cultivation has become the inevitable choice of industry sustainable development.The artemisia annua artemislnin content of China's southwest growth is apparently higher than domestic and international other areas, and artemisia annua can both be planted for 500 meters to 2500 meters from height above sea level by Yunnan Province, in Yunnan Province's development artemisia annua industry significant advantage is arranged.The tame correlative study report of domestic existing artemisia annua, relevant scholar's research shows [1-6]: seeding quantity, planting density, base manure kind and the period of topdressing, gather etc. all has appreciable impact to artemisia annua output and artemislnin content, but yet there are no the report of artemisia annua film-mulching cultivation technique research.

Embodiment:
The present invention is an example with artemisia annua fine provenance " Yuanyang provenance ", experimental field is located at three-family village, Qilin District Zhu Jie township, Qujing, Yunnan Province, height above sea level 2200m, and preceding stubble wheat, physical features is smooth, and soil property is a dam district yellow ground loam, middle fertility.But content of the present invention not only is confined to embodiment.
One, little shed is grown seedlings
1, the preparation of nursery lot: the place that because artemisia annua seed very tiny (thousand kernel weight only 0.05 gram), that nursery lot requires to select is smooth, the soil is porous, fertility abundance, drainage are good, have the water source.That the seedbed will be accomplished is one flat, two thin (grogs diameter<0.2cm), three fertilizer, four tides (profit).Divide the moisture in the soil sowing, the wide 100cm of moisture in the soil, high 15 or 20cm, long 5 or 10m.Carry out conventional sterilization, desinsection processing with carbendazim or geaster before the sowing;
2, sowing: by the end of February-the early March seeding and seedling raising, seeding quantity is 200 gram/mus, the ratio that adds 2 kilograms of sand in 100 gram seeds is evenly dressed seed.It is moistening before the sowing furrow face fully to be watered, with the seed uniform broadcasting of mixing on the furrow face, the lid layer fine earth, water spray, the furrow face is fully moistening, pine tag or straw covering.
3, build the little shed of lid: build half meter high little shed with bamboo chip and plastic film along the furrow face, little shed plastic foil is fixing on one side, and the another side slip helps watering, when fertilising, weeding.
4, nursery bed management and transplanting: the control seedling bed temperature is 15 ℃-30 ℃, and humidity is 40-50%, and timely Ex-all weeds; In the time of height of seedling 5-6 centimetre, remove the film hardening; When growing to 10cm, seedling carries out suitable thinning; Late April is to mid-May, when the true leaf number of blade 6-8 of seedling sheet, leaf look green or dark green, plant height 10-15cm, the long 5cm of root transplants when above, transplanting time is no more than mid-June at the latest; Transplant the land for growing field crops when getting seedling, along the 8cm translation of burying of furrow face horizontal direction, accomplish balled transplanting as far as possible, shorten seedling-slowing stage, improve survival rate with mamoty or hoe.
Two, land for growing field crops plastic film mulching cultivation
1, choosing ground, whole ground, basal dressing: select the gentle slope plantation artemisia annua of about 15 degree of guaranteed nonirrigated farmland, water source or field piece or the gradient, can arrive the survival rate more than 95% after not only can guaranteeing to transplant, and be beneficial to draining, reduce the disease of bringing because of accumulated water.Plough or manually turn over to dig with ox and harrow carefully wholely, the degree of depth is more than 30cm.Every mu of organic fertilizer (or pond sludge, humus soil etc.) adds the composite fertilizer that buys in 40 kilograms of markets for 3000 kilograms and makes base fertilizer.Excavation is ridged, and does 0.8 or 1 meter not lend oneself to worry and anxiety of grooving, the long ridge of ditch depth 30 or 35 or 40 centimetres.
2, planting density: it is fixed to look soil fertility, 0.40 * 0.80 meter of the low soil seeding row spacing of soil fertility, every mu of plantation 2000 strains; The soil that soil fertility is high: 0.50 * 1.0 meter of seeding row spacing, every mu of plantation 1300 strains.
3, field planting method: dig the cave with little mamoty or spud, with the open and flat cave of putting in strong sprout that fetch in the seedbed, earthing gently presses down soil compaction with have gentle hands, irrigates normal root water immediately.
4, epiphragma: transplant earlier the back epiphragma: epiphragma immediately after the artemisia annua field planting, cover along the furrow face with 0.7 plastic film, mulch film there being the seedling place that film is cut off an osculum, is exposed with the seedling acrial part, with soil pressure in fact again at the opening part earthing in both sides.Or transplant training behind the first epiphragma: managed moisture in the soil, accomplish fluently the pool, behind the Shi Haofei, mulch film on the moisture in the soil cover press the seeding row spacing transplanting again, and in opening part earthing, compacting.
Field management:
1, seedling-slowing stage management: field planting was looked into seedling and is filled the gaps with seedlings in full field after 10 days, and water 1 10 day every day after the field planting in summer, and per 2 days of dry season watered 1 time, and the soil field humidity remains on 60-70%; After transplanting a week, mu is with composite fertilizer 10 or 15 kilograms of fertilisings, or waters fertilising with the composite fertilizer of the market purchase of percentage by weight 0.3% is soluble in water;
2, seedling management: the soil field humidity remains on 60-70%; Topdress twice, that is: transplant after 15 or 20 days, open for every mu and spread manuer in holes 20 kilograms of composite fertilizers or use well-rotted farmyard manure, carry out earth backing after the fertilising; Transplant after 35 or 40 or 45 days, execute composite fertilizer or the farmyard manure that 20 kilograms of markets are bought for every mu, in conjunction with earthing up, weeding 1 or 2 times; The same convention amount of the amount of application of farmyard manure.
3, budding-management picking time: water management: keep field soil humidity at 60-70%.Soil moisture<60% must water (filling) water; Soil moisture>70% in time digs trenches to drain the water away, and forbids field raceway groove accumulated water.2. fertilising: impose 5 to 10 kilograms of NPK composite fertilizers (look growing state determine), convert water and water for 1000 kilograms and execute.
4, the extermination of disease and insect pest: for artemisia annua root, stem rot with disease prestige or the topsin of going out; Powdery mildew is clever with the powder rust; Chafer and aphid carry out conventional control only with Rogor or the speed aphid lice of going out.Prevent and treat the same conventional method of method of operating.
The inventive method practical application shows: the one, and identical plot, under the identical cultivation management condition, the plant growing way of film-mulching cultivation is relatively good.With " Yuanyang provenance " is example, and plant height increases 12.6cm, and basic stem increases thick 0.72cm, and branch amount increases by 8.4, and the hat width of cloth increases 178.5cm.The 2nd, film-mulching cultivation has improved single plant yield and quality.Wherein, complete stool acrial part weight has increased by 1.35 kilograms, and the individual plant stem heavily increases by 0.03 kilogram, and leaf flower bud fresh weight has increased by 0.32 kilogram.Artemislnin content is increased to 0.75% by 0.64%, has increased by 0.11%.The 3rd, film-mulching cultivation can improve 0.5-7.5 ℃ of 5-25cm plow layer ground temperature.Because spring temperature and ground temperature are all on the low side, utilize plastic mulching not only can transplant the phase (generally doing sth. in advance more than 20 day) ahead of time than open country, and, because the artemisia annua root system mainly is distributed in 5 to 30 centimetres plow layer, the increase of soil temperature in the epiphragma caudacoria, promote microbial activities, accelerated organic matter decomposition, effectively promoted the absorption of root system nutrition material and moisture content; On the other hand, the moisture content tunicle of soil evaporation behind the epiphragma stops, water conservation arranged preferably, propose the moisture in the soil effect; In addition, mulch film reflection optical energy irradiation artemisia annua plant lower blade and leaf back increase bottom leaf colourity, improve chrysanthemum mugwort portion quality, reach artemisia annua high-quality and aim of high yield.
